Aperçu

L’API OpenPhone permet aux développeurs d’intégrer les fonctionnalités de communication d’OpenPhone directement dans leurs applications et processus de travail. Envoyez des messages, gérez les contacts et automatisez les processus de communication par programmation.
L’accès à l’API nécessite un abonnement OpenPhone actif et des autorisations de Propriétaire ou d’Administrateur pour votre espace de travail.

Commencer avec l’API

Prérequis

Exigences pour l’accès à l’API :
  • Abonnement OpenPhone actif (tout forfait)
  • Rôle de propriétaire ou d’administrateur dans votre espace de travail
  • Enregistrement auprès d’un transporteur américain complété pour l’envoi de messages vers les numéros américains
  • Crédits prépayés pour la messagerie par API

Documentation de l’API

Accédez à une documentation et des ressources complètes pour l’API : Disponible dans notre documentation de l’API :
  • Configuration et authentification étape par étape
  • Référence complète des points de terminaison
  • Exemples de code et SDK
  • Limites de débit et meilleures pratiques
  • Informations sur la tarification et la facturation

Capacités de l’API

Fonctionnalité de base

Points de terminaison API disponibles :
  • Envoyer des messages : Envoyer des SMS/MMS de façon programmatique
  • Gérer les contacts : Créer, mettre à jour et organiser les contacts
  • Récupérer les conversations : Accéder à l’historique des messages et aux fils de discussion
  • Intégration webhook : Recevoir des notifications d’événements en temps réel

Fonctionnalités de messagerie

Types de messages pris en charge :
  • Messages texte SMS vers les numéros américains, canadiens et internationaux
  • Messages MMS avec pièces jointes multimédias
  • Fonctionnalités de messagerie de groupe
  • Suivi du statut des messages et confirmation de livraison

Tarification et facturation

Coûts des messages API

Système de crédits prépayés :
  • Messages américains et canadiens : 0,01 $ par segment de message
  • Messages internationaux : 0,01 $ par segment + tarifs internationaux
  • Crédits prépayés requis : Achat via les paramètres de facturation
  • Aucuns frais mensuels d’API : Payez seulement pour les messages envoyés
La messagerie API nécessite des crédits prépayés. Les messages échoueront si les crédits disponibles sont insuffisants.

Segments de message

Fonctionnement des segments de message :
  • SMS standard : 160 caractères = 1 segment
  • SMS Unicode/emoji : 70 caractères = 1 segment
  • Les messages plus longs se divisent automatiquement en plusieurs segments
  • Les messages MMS comptent comme un seul segment, peu importe la taille du contenu

Authentification et sécurité

Clés d’API

Authentification sécurisée :
  • Générez des clés d’API dans les paramètres de l’espace de travail
  • Les clés permettent un accès sécurisé aux données de votre espace de travail
  • Régénérez les clés si elles sont compromises
  • Utilisez des variables d’environnement pour stocker les clés de façon sécuritaire

Limites de taux

Limites d’utilisation de l’API :
  • Conçues pour prévenir les abus et assurer la fiabilité
  • Les limites varient selon le point de terminaison et le niveau d’abonnement
  • Surveillez l’utilisation grâce aux réponses de l’API
  • Contactez le soutien technique pour obtenir des limites plus élevées au besoin

Exemples d’intégration

Cas d’utilisation courants

Implémentations d’API populaires :
  • Notifications clients : Mises à jour de commandes, rappels de rendez-vous
  • Automatisation marketing : Campagnes promotionnelles, séquences de suivi
  • Flux de travail de support : Notifications de billets, mises à jour de statut
  • Intégration CRM : Synchronisation des contacts et de l’historique de communication

Ressources de développement

Pour commencer rapidement :
  • Explorateur d’API interactif dans la documentation
  • Exemples de code dans plusieurs langages de programmation
  • Collection Postman pour les tests
  • Exemples et modèles de la communauté

Intégrations connexes

Explorez les intégrations prêtes à utiliser qui complètent l’utilisation de l’API :
Consultez toutes les intégrations disponibles sur notre page d’intégrations, incluant Salesforce, HubSpot et Gong.